Acting Director-General of the Department of Social Development pointed out the importance of SASSA into Education

Acting Director-General of the Department of Social Development, Advocate Gugulethu Thimane, speaking on the purpose of today’s engagement in Mdantsane , said the occasion marks the launch of a landmark report tracing the journey and impact of government investment through social grants.

Thimane said “The report provides credible, evidence-based findings on the educational performance of learners who are beneficiaries of social grants and related social protection services.

“It translates government investment in the social assistance and related programmes into real improvements in people’s lives.”

Thimane emphasised that social protection must be understood not only as a poverty alleviation tool, but as a developmental investment that transforms lives and improves educational outcomes.

She said “Combining social grants with access to education, care, nutrition and psychosocial support increases opportunities for children to complete schooling and escape the poverty cycle.”

Adv Thimane further underscored that sustainable development cannot be achieved in isolation, highlighting the critical role of partnerships with faith-based organisations, international development partners, academia, civil society and NPOs.

She also highlighted NSFAS as a key strategic partner in enabling children from previously disadvantaged backgrounds to access higher education and unlock greater opportunities.
